Abstract

Provided is a dual-axis rotation folder-type mobile communication terminal including a main body, a folder rotatable about a first hinge axis having two positions respectively in a latitudinal direction and a longitudinal direction of the main body to open and close a top face of the main body, and a rotation hinge unit rotatable about a second hinge axis a predetermined degree to change a position of the first axis.
